After former House Speaker Kevin McCarthy (R-CA) was removed from his post, U.S. Representatives from around the country have provided their statements regarding the historic vote that led to the demise of the top Republican in the House.
Representative Chip Roy (R-TX) stated that he disagreed with the decision to remove McCarthy, calling it an improper “tactical play call.”
Rep. Roy – who voted against removing McCarthy, released this statement before the vote to motion to vacate.
